The Importance of a Reliable Locksmith
Losing or damaging your car key can be more than simply an inconvenience; it can be a substantial security problem. Modern car keys are equipped with sophisticated security features like transponders, chips, and fobs, making it hard to replicate or replace them without specialized knowledge and equipment. A reputable locksmith can provide a variety of services, including key duplication, lock rekeying, and even programming new keyless entry systems. They can also help you gain back access to your vehicle rapidly and safely.
What Services Does a Locksmith Offer?
When you look for a "locksmith near me" for car key services, you can expect a variety of professional services:
Key Duplication
Standard Keys: Creating a specific copy of your existing car key.Transponder Keys: Duplicating keys which contain a microchip to avoid unapproved access.Laser-Cut Keys: Replicating keys with intricate cuts that fit modern-day, high-security locks.
Key Extraction and Replacement
Broken Keys: Removing a broken key from the lock and replacing it with a brand-new one.Stuck Keys: If your key is stuck in the ignition or door lock, a locksmith can securely eliminate it without damaging the lock.
Key Programming
Remote Fobs: Programming brand-new or replacement remote fobs for keyless entry systems.Smart Keys: Configuring wise keys that can start the car without physical insertion.
Lock Rekeying
Altering Locks: Rekeying your car's locks to use a brand-new key, improving security.Master Key Systems: Setting up a master key system for fleet lorries or companies.
Emergency Lockout Assistance
24/7 Availability: Most dependable locksmith professionals provide 24/7 emergency situation services to assist you restore access to your vehicle at any time.

Q: Can a locksmith make a copy of my car key without the initial?
A: In lots of cases, a locksmith can create a new key if you have the vehicle's VIN number and proof of ownership. However, this process might differ depending on the make and design of your car and the security features of your key. For high-security keys, the original key is frequently needed for duplication.
Q: How long does it require to get a duplicate car key?
A: The time it requires to duplicate a car key can differ depending on the kind of key and the locksmith's workload. Standard keys can often be duplicated within minutes, while more complicated keys like transponder or laser-cut keys might take 30 minutes to an hour.
Q: What should I do if my car key is broken inside the lock?
A: Do not try to require the key out, as this can damage the lock even more. Rather, call an expert locksmith who has the tools and competence to safely extract the broken key without causing additional damage.
Q: Can a locksmith program my car's remote fob?
A: Yes, an expert locksmith can program a brand-new or replacement remote fob for your car. This process includes integrating the fob with your car's computer system, which might need particular diagnostic tools.
Q: Are mobile locksmith services as trustworthy as those with a physical shop?
A: Mobile locksmith professionals can be simply as trustworthy and often more hassle-free. Try to find mobile locksmith professionals who are licensed, guaranteed, and have favorable reviews. They must have the ability to offer the same quality services as a shop-based locksmith.
